When Dr. Kolawole Daniel Olukoya was born, little did his parents, Mr. and Mrs. Olukoya, know that they had taken delivery of an exceptional child ordained by God to fulfill a destiny that would in turn, positively affect the destiny of others. And in pursuit of that destiny, Dr. Olukoya laid down an academic blueprint whose pedigree remains outstanding. At Saint John’s CAC Primary School, Akure in Ondo State, and Saint Jude’s primary School, Ebute Metta, Lagos where he completed his primary education.

Dr. Daniel Olukoya’s academic profile took a leap while at Methodist Boys’ High School, Lagos , where he graduated with Grade One Distinction and was the best student in his set. He proceeded to the prestigious University of Lagos and graduated with a first class honours degree. In fact it was the first from the department since the university was established in 1962.

Dr. Olukoya’s thirst for more academic laurels found expression at the University of Reading, UK, where, with a Commonwealth scholarship, he studied for a PhD in Molecular Genet­ics, which was completed in record time, making him probably the first Nigerian to obtain a Ph.D. in this subject area. On his return to Nigeria, his first port of call was the Nigerian Institute of Medical Research (NIMR), Yaba. He was a lecturer as well as external examiner to a number of Nigerian universities, among them the University of Lagos , UNILAG and university of Benin, UNIBEN.

Dr. Olukoya has supervised over 20 Ph.D. students. As a researcher, he has over 80 scientific publications to his credit. Notwithstanding his exploits on the academic turf, he de­votes much of his time to God through preaching, delivering papers at seminars, singing etc. That Dr. Olukoya would become a mighty tool in the hands of God to serve as a vehicle of deliverance for his generation manifested in 1989, when Mountain of Fire and Miracles Minis­tries was given birth to in his sitting room at Yaba, with 24 worshippers. Now, Mountain of Fire and Miracles Ministries, with only 25 years presence, can be found in several parts of the world – it spreads across Nigeria , Africa and Asia . A huge percentage of branches are also located in the United States and Europe .

His quest for the improvement of life for the youths has culminated in the creation of the MountainTop University (MTU) and even the MFM Football Club to afford youths with talents in sports an expression.

His talent and passion for music is evidenced by his composition of over 200 choral works in English, Yoruba and pidgin languages with over 30 songs for Solo Singing, and over 100 songs for Praise and Worship of the Most High God.
